[tint][inspector] Make Get*TextureBinding private. They are not used by Dawn and centralizing on GetResourceBindings will help support binding_array in the inspector in the future. Inspector tests are updated as needed, with duplicate tests removed now that they all use GetResourceBindings. Dawn is an open-source and cross-platform implementation of the WebGPU standard. More precisely it implements webgpu.h
that is a one-to-one mapping with the WebGPU IDL. Dawn is meant to be integrated as part of a larger system and is the underlying implementation of WebGPU in Chromium.
